Break the Circle

82 minutes - Ukraine 2021

Genre Documentary

Category Full-length documentary

Director Yelizaveta Smіt

A film about the journey of survivors of domestic violence. These are the stories of women, each of whom is transforming her life by breaking free from the cycle of violence. But these changes turn out to be a long and complex process of working on themselves and their relationships with the world around them. From calling the police and living in a shelter to rediscovering themselves, these women find the courage to embark on this journey for their own sake and for that of their children.

The film was produced with the support of the United Nations Population Fund (UNFPA) in Ukraine as part of the EMBRACE project to combat and prevent gender-based violence, with support from the UK Government.

Yurik. The Road, Without Touching the Ground

107 minutes - UkraineEstonia 2023

Genre DramaWar

Director Oleksandr Tіmenko

The war destroyed Yurii's happy family in a terrible way: his father, grandfather and younger sister were killed in enemy shelling. One day, his mother realised that in his hometown, Yuriy was in danger of being taken to Russia by the occupiers. For her son's sake, she made the most difficult decision of her life — to tear her child away from her so that he could escape and live in safety with relatives in Estonia. She stays at home, in the basement of their house, to take care of her sick grandmother.

Alone, with his mother's phone number on his back, Yuriy will make his way to the safety of the border: by train, by car, with the military in an APC, under fire and in occupied cities, finding a short rest with kind people. The power of love will guide him through the war. And all along the way, he will remember his mother's words: “As long as you live, I will live.”

Great Ukrainians. Viacheslav Chornovil

25 minutes - Ukraine 2008

Genre Documentary

Director Denis Snighko

A film from the documentary series Great Ukrainians.

About Vyacheslav Chornovil (1937–1999) — a politician, Soviet dissident, journalist and one of the founders of the People’s Movement of Ukraine.

The film features archive footage.
